Stone masonry installation involves the skilled placement and assembly of natural or manufactured stone materials to create durable and attractive structures. This service typically includes building walls, facades, patios, steps, and decorative features that add both aesthetic appeal and structural integrity to a property. Experienced contractors handle the entire process, from selecting the appropriate stones to carefully fitting each piece, ensuring a long-lasting result that enhances the property's overall appearance.
This service can address a variety of common problems faced by homeowners. For example, stone masonry can reinforce weak or damaged foundations, repair cracked or crumbling walls, and replace deteriorated surfaces that no longer provide proper support or protection. It also offers solutions for creating sturdy outdoor features that withstand weather conditions and regular use. Properly installed stone features can prevent further damage and reduce the need for frequent repairs, making it a practical choice for maintaining property value and safety.

The overview below groups typical Stone Masonry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for common repair jobs like replacing damaged stones or filling cracks.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, making it the most common expense for minor work.
Surface Restoration - restoring or sealing existing stonework us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 depending on the size and condition of the project. Larger, more detailed restoration projects can reach $4,000 or more, but these are less frequent.
New Installation - installing new stone features or structures generally costs from $3,000 to $8,000 for standard projects. Larger or more complex installations, such as custom designs or extensive walls, can exceed $10,000.
Full Replacement - replacing existing stonework entirely can range from $5,000 to $15,000+, depending on the scope and materials involved. Many projects fall into the lower to mid-tier range, with high-end custom work reaching hig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
